Setting Up a New Toilet Flange:



  • Choosing the Right Replacement Flange


  • When installing a new toilet flange, the first step is to choose the appropriate replacement for your plumbing configuration. Consider variables such as the product of the flange, with options consisting of PVC, ABS, or cast iron. PVC flanges are understood for their cost and resistance to deterioration, making them a prominent selection for DIY enthusiasts. ABS flanges offer comparable benefits to PVC however brag included toughness, making them appropriate for high-traffic areas or industrial settings. Cast iron flanges, renowned for their stamina and durability, are optimal for installations where longevity is extremely important. Furthermore, make certain that the substitute flange is correctly sized and fits snugly right into location to create a leak-proof seal and prevent leakages.

    Safeguarding the Flange to the Floor:



    When you've selected the appropriate substitute flange, it's critical to protect it effectively to the floor to make sure security and stop future issues. Begin by placing and aligning the flange properly over the drain, guaranteeing that it rests flush with the floor surface. Relying on the sort of flange and your specific setup choices, you can secure the flange to the flooring utilizing screws or sticky. If making use of screws, make certain to make use of corrosion-resistant options to prevent rusting over time. Conversely, adhesive can supply a safe bond in between the flange and the floor, guaranteeing a sturdy and reliable installment. By complying with these actions and taking the essential preventative measures, you can install a new bathroom flange with confidence, guaranteeing a long-lasting and leak-free plumbing component.

    In addition to product factors to consider, commode flanges additionally are available in different design and styles to suit various plumbing configurations and installation preferences. Offset flanges, for example, are made to suit bathrooms installed on floors that are uneven or where the drain lies off-centre. Similarly, repair work flanges, also referred to as fixing rings or spacer rings, are utilized to deal with issues such as broken or broken flanges without the requirement for comprehensive plumbing modifications. Furthermore, flexible flanges provide adaptability ready, permitting exact placement and fit during installment. By discovering the diverse range of toilet flange kinds and styles offered, you can select the option that finest suits your plumbing setup and installation demands, ensuring a smooth and trustworthy option for your bathroom fixtures.

    TOILET REPAIR HOW TO REPLACE A BROKEN TOILET FLANGE


    First remove the toilet. Turn off the water line, flush the toilet, and remove the water line from the bottom of the toilet tank. Have bucket handy, as water will come out of the tank. Sponge out as much water from the tank and bowl as you can. A handyman trick is to use a wet dry shop vac to suck all the water out of the bowl and tank.


    Remove the nuts on each side of the base of the toilet. These nuts-bolts attach the toilet to the flange. You may have to use a saw to cut the nuts off, which is ok, because you are going to put in new toilet bolts and nuts. The flange, when brand new, is attached to the waste pipe. Many times it rusts or snaps off. Tilt the toilet on its side and move out of the way. Have a helper assist you in moving the toilet, they are heavy and bulky.


    Use a putty knife to remove the wax ring residue from the exposed flange and inspect the flange and surrounding area. What is key here is if the wood subfloor is rotted. If this is the case, you will have to cut out the surrounding subfloor and replace it with new plywood, then fix the flange.



    Thankfully on this home improvement project, the subfloor was fine, just the flange fell apart. Go to your hardware store and buy a Super Ring Replacement Toilet Ring. There are several models by different suppliers, don't buy the cheapest one, its your toilet, remember...



    Also at the hardware store buy new toilet mounting bolts, they usually come in a package with the nuts and washers.


    Put the toilet mounting bolts in the flange pointing up, and use some wax from the old wax ring to hold them in place. Place the super ring replacement toilet ring over the waste line, making sure the mounting bolts are in the same place as the original bolts were, one bolt on each side of the flange.



    Screw the new flange into the subfloor. You may have to use a hammer drill to drill through existing tile flooring or cement substrate. Set the new toilet wax ring onto the flange on the base of the toilet, and guide the toilet back onto the super ring, making sure the toilet mounting bolts are lined up with the mount holes in the toilet base. The super ring toilet ring allows for you to adjust the location of the bolts.
